scope of analysis is a function to retrieve additional information about each dimensional object from the database. Initially the extra data disappear in the reports of webI. we can refine this extra data through use of scope of analysis levels.
In webI we have 5 levels for scope of analysis. They are Non level, level one,level two,level three, custom level.
Ex: I have one report that contains of 2010 data.
if I want find out 2010 quarter -1 data.
I will set up level 2 scope of analysis.
The web I users can save their time using custom Scope of analysis then drill down.
